Bruno Guimaraes failed to arrive at La Manga for Newcastle's pre‑season training camp on Sunday night, missing the planned meeting with his teammates. The delay occurs as the team prepares for the upcoming season and the coaching staff had scheduled drills at the Spanish venue. However, Sky Sports News reports that the Newcastle captain is still expected to travel and join the squad, and the club remains relaxed about the delay.

Guimaraes told Newcastle officials last month that he wants to move to Arsenal, and he has indicated he would only join the Premier League champions if they make an acceptable offer. The club has been monitoring the situation closely.

Matthias Jaissle, the new manager appointed to replace Eddie Howe, is present at La Manga with his newly assembled squad and is eager to meet the captain. Newcastle remain cautious, as no formal club‑to‑club dialogue has taken place despite widespread rumors, and the coaching staff is keen to assess whether the midfielder will stay or depart.

The midfielder has two years left on his contract, with a club‑held option for an additional year, and Newcastle want him to stay as they await an acceptable offer from Arsenal.
